Santa Anita race track opened in 1934 and features a one mile dirt track and 7/8 mile turf course. Santa Anita will host the 2019 Breeders' Cup. You can find both Santa Anita entries and Santa Anita results here.
Racing: December to July, Sept - October.
Santa Anita's biggest stakes: Santa Anita Derby, Santa Anita Handicap, Shoemaker Mile, American Oaks.
